I use about 2.88kW an hour in my one bedroom apartment, is that a lot?
There are 3 heaters, one in the bedroom, the bathroom, and the living-room. At most 12 light bulbs are on at a time and they are all fluorescent CFLs or tubes. I have 2 computers, both single core cpu’s, and single hard drives. A full sized refridgerator and a heating blanket. I left all of these on, for the most part, for 48 hours and I used 138.384kW which is about 2.88kW per hour. Is that a lot for my one bedroom apartment?
The cost per kWh is 0.046070 + environmental charge of 0.002910 + fuel (coal or nuclear) charge of 0.028710. So everyday costs about $5.37 which is about $175 after service fees.
With all of that stuff running, that’s not a lot. It’s the equivalent of forty eight 60-watt light bulbs running all of the time. Your three heaters are probably the biggest electric consumers. Each probably requires about 1200 watts when the electric coil is powered. If the 1200 watt/heater estimate is correct, and they’re on for an hour, you’ve used about 3.6 kW-hrs. If you can avoid running the heaters, that would probably save the most. Your total charges come to $0.07769 per kW-hr, which is on the low side for electric rates nowadays.
I will mention that I one time had a townhouse where I felt the electric bill was high, and nothing I did seemed to reduce it. To make a long story short, it turned out that the electric company had confused my meter with my neighbor’s, so I was being billed for their electricity and they were being billed for mine. To test this, locate your electric meter (find the meter with the serial number that corresponds to the serial number on your electric bill), then turn off every circuit breaker in you breaker box. If your meter is still spinning with all of the breakers turned off, then you’re being billed for someone else’s electricity.

Food poisoning is a common, yet distressing and sometimes life-threatening problem for millions of people in the U.S., and throughout the world. People infected with foodborne organisms may be symptom-free or may have symptoms ranging from mild intestinal discomfort to severe dehydration and bloody diarrhea. Depending on the type of infection, people can even die as a result of food poisoning.
Food Poisoning Symptoms
Noroviruses are a group of viruses that cause a mild illness (often termed “stomach flu”) with nausea, vomiting, diarrhea, abdominal pain, headache, and low-grade fever. These symptoms usually resolve in two to three days. It is the most common viral cause of adult food poisoning and is transmitted from water, shellfish, and vegetables contaminated by feces, as well as from person to person.
Symptoms of scombroid poisoning will usually develop 20 to 30 minutes after you eat an affected fish. They can include flushing (turning red), nausea, vomiting, hives and difficulty breathing. These symptoms are similar to other allergic reactions. However, getting scombroid poisoning does not mean you are allergic to fish.
Causes of Food Poisoning
Food poisoning can affect one person or it can occur as an outbreak in a group of people who all ate the same contaminated food.
Even though food poisoning is relatively rare in the United States, it affects between 60 and 80 million .
The most common causes are as follows: (1) leaving prepared food at temperatures that allow bacterial growth, (2) inadequate cooking or reheating, (3) cross-contamination, and (4) infection in food handlers. Cross-contamination may occur when raw contaminated food comes in contact with other foods, especially cooked foods, through direct contact or indirect contact on food preparation surfaces.

Diagnosis Food Poisoning
One important aspect of diagnosing food poisoning is for doctors to determine if a number of people have eaten the same food and show the same symptoms of illness. When this happens, food poisoning is strongly suspected. The diagnosis is confirmed when the suspected bacteria is found in a stool culture or a fecal smear from the person. Other laboratory tests are used to isolate bacteria from a sample of the contaminated food. Botulism is usually diagnosed from its distinctive neurological symptoms, since rapid treatment is essential.

What kind of testing is done after your diabetes diagnosis? My doctor discovered it thru a blood glucose, now how do they find out what type of diabetes it is? I have many symptoms such excessive urination, lightheadedness, food cravings, numb hands & feet, dry mouth, fluid retention, just to name a few. Does chronic fatigue & blackouts play a role as well? I would appreciate any help you can offer me. Thanks, starbuck1951
hyperglycemia can definitely cause chronic fatigue because the body isnt getting the sugar it needs into the cells (where it uses the sugar to give you energy). instead, all of your sugar is floating around in the blood going unused, and as far as the body is concerned, it isnt there because it cant get into the cell without insulin (which acts like the key to unlock the cell to let the sugar in to be used for energy). so yes, hyperglycemia can definitely cause chronic fatigue. blackouts and fainting is also possible if you have too much sugar floating around in your brain because if your brain isnt getting enough glucose/sugar (glucose is the only type of eneryg the brain can use), then it can black out until your body figures out a way to get your brain the proper energy. i am guessing you probably have type 2 (adult onset) diabetes unless you are very young (like under age 18), then it would be type 1 (which is inherited and you usually have either from birth or from early childhood). your doctor should be able to give you a good diet and exercise routine to help control your sugars, as well as the proper insulins.

Pneumonia is an inflammatory illness of the lung. Currently, over 3 million people develop pneumonia each year in the United States. It usually caused by infection with bacteria, viruses, fungi or other organisms. Pneumonia is a particular concern for older adults and people with chronic illnesses or impaired immune systems, but it can also strike young, healthy people. Having a long-term, or chronic, disease like asthma, heart disease, cancer, or diabetes also makes you more likely to get pneumonia. People most at risk are older than 65 or younger than 2 years of age, or already have health problems. Herpes simplex virus is a rare cause of pneumonia except in newborns. People with immune system problems are also at risk of pneumonia caused by cytomegalovirus (CMV).
People with infectious pneumonia often have a cough producing greenish or yellow sputum and a high fever that may be conducted by shaking chills. Shortness of breath is also common. People with pneumonia may cough up blood, experience headaches, or develop sweaty and clammy skin. Other possible symptoms are loss of appetite, fatigue, blueness of the skin, nausea, vomiting, mood swings, and joint pains or muscle aches. In some people, particularly the elderly and those who are debilitated, bacterial pneumonia may follow influenza or even a common cold. People with weak immune systems at greatest risk of pneumonia. Sometimes pneumonia can lead to additional complications. Complications are more frequently associated with bacterial pneumonia than with viral pneumonia.
